The end of October is just a few days away and with it comes shops selling scary fancy dress outfits, pumpkins and vats of sweets. Come October 31st children will be decked out and knocking on doors in search of treats.
But is there an alternative? What if you don’t celebrate Halloween and are looking to encourage your children to do the same? Or if you know you’ll be receiving visits from excited, sugar-hyped children but want a way to bless them and their families?
The Meaningful Treat Box is that such alternative. Created by the company behind the Real Advent Calendar, the Meaningful Treat Box is a new resource designed to help with mission work leading up Halloween.
Inside each Meaningful Treat Pack there is:
-
A packet of Fairtrade chocolate buttons - Tasty treats to delight even the fussiest eater
-
Challenge activity poster - an action-packed booklet filled with mazes, word searches, prayers and more all with themes of good winning over bad
With 30 packets in the box, that’s just £1 per treat.
The Meaningful Treat Box is available to order now for delivery in time for Halloween.
